Scientists have recently developed a novel nanobody-based treatment for retinitis pigmentosa (RP), an inherited eye disorder that causes progressive vision loss and eventual blindness. This groundbreaking treatment has been shown to slow the progression of the disease, providing hope for patients suffering from RP. The nanobodies are engineered proteins that interact directly with damaged retinal cells, acting as a sort of “repair kit” to help restore their function. This exciting development marks a major breakthrough in the field of ophthalmology and could potentially revolutionize the way RP is treated in the future.
